I've done alot of reading on useing chicken litter. I desided to try in. Talked to the egg man that came into where I have coffee every morn. He said hell no we don,t give that stuff away its like liquid gold. He then invited me to come out and see how they used it.
When I got there I was blown away, everything was totally automated. 3 men opperateing about a dozen houses, hundreds of thousands of chickens. Below the rows of cages there was a big bar extending from one side to other. The bar moved back and forth while pulling the litter into a large vat at the end. It was mixed with water, maybe it was like a hugh septic tank. The slurry was then pumped into an irragation system and added to the water. It could be sent to one of many pastures. The man told they make about as much on the hay as the eggs. Caint get nothin free no more.
